About The Common Good - Aurora
The Common Good - Aurora is a restaurant, bar, breakfast restaurant, brunch restaurant, lunch restaurant, cocktail bar, and wine bar in Aurora, Colorado. It serves breakfast, brunch, lunch, and dinner, with offerings that include comfort food, small plates, coffee, cocktails, beer, wine, and happy hour drinks and food. Reviewers consistently praise the flavorful food, strong coffee and cocktails, and attentive service. Commonly mentioned dishes include eggs benedict, shrimp and grits, burritos, banana pancakes, and the cinnamon roll.

Frequently asked questions
What is The Common Good - Aurora known for?
It is especially known for brunch dishes like eggs benedict, shrimp and grits, and breakfast plates such as the All American Breakfast and potatoes, peppers, spinach hash with eggs. Reviewers also call out the burrito, coffee, and cocktails, saying the food is hot, fresh, and flavorful.
What dishes are most recommended at The Common Good - Aurora?
Reviewers repeatedly recommend the classic Eggs Benny, eggs benedict with brown butter hollandaise, shrimp and grits, rosemary smashed potatoes, banana pancakes, falafel pockets, lamb rigatoni, and the cinnamon roll. The pistachio latte with almond milk and cappuccinos are also singled out for being very good.
What is the atmosphere like at The Common Good - Aurora?
The space is described as casual, cozy, quiet, trendy, and upscale, with a beautiful lobby and a warm interior. It works well for groups and solo dining, and reviewers mention a positive brunch atmosphere without loud music.
Is The Common Good - Aurora good value?
Yes, reviewers describe the $20 to $30 price range as very reasonable or agreeable for the quality of the dishes. Several mention generous satisfaction from items like the burrito, brunch plates, and coffee, though one review notes portions can feel just right for bigger eaters who may want a side.
Do you need a reservation or should you plan ahead for brunch?
Brunch reservations are recommended, and the restaurant accepts reservations. Reviews say Sunday morning can be busy but sometimes has no wait, so booking ahead is a practical choice for peak brunch times.
